before we add support for a bunch of useless emulators we should better provide support for more mainstream software ...

support for .net ?

hard to realize and there are alternative runtimes for nlite available ...

support for steam?

I didn't test it on microwinx

but if you use steam on a windows without IE, you will have to add 127.0.0.1 steampowered.com to your host file to get rid of the annoying popups because of the embedded html-sites in steam

Filezilla:

comctl32.dll, winspool.drv

PROBLEM: starting program and nothing happens

rechecked that program

seems that filezilla only needs: riched20.dll

maybe it needs additional registry entries (I tested some registry stuff in advance, anyway if they are needed, I've got them)
